What Does Doge Mean In Government (Definition and Origin)
In a government context the word doge refers to a historical political leader. It was the title given to the chief magistrate or ruler of certain Italian city states during the Middle Ages and Renaissance.
The most famous use of the title doge comes from:
- The Republic of Venice
- The Republic of Genoa
A doge was not exactly a king but also not just a regular official. The role was unique.
Key points about a doge
- The doge was the highest authority in the state
- He was usually elected rather than born into power
- His powers were often limited by councils or assemblies
- The position was for life in many cases
The word doge comes from the Latin word dux which means leader or commander. It is related to words like duke in English.

How the Doge Ruled in Government Systems
The role of a doge was powerful but not absolute. Unlike kings the doge had to follow strict rules.
Election Process
The doge was chosen through a complex voting system. In Venice this process involved multiple rounds of selection to prevent corruption or bias.
Limited Power
Even though the doge was the head of state he could not make decisions alone. Councils and assemblies shared power.
Lifetime Position
Once elected the doge usually served for life. However he could be removed in rare cases.
Symbol of the State
The doge represented the unity and authority of the republic. He attended ceremonies led official events and acted as the public face of the government.
